Embassy of Oman to Tunisia celebrates 53rd National Day

Dr Hilal Abdullah Ali Alsanani, Ambassador of the Sultanate of Oman accredited to the Republic of Tunisia, held a ceremony on the occasion of the 53rd National Day of Oman in Tunisia.

The ceremony was attended by Minister of Education, Mohamed Ali Boughdiri, Minister of Religious Affairs, a number of political figures in Tunisia, heads of Arab and foreign diplomatic missions, Arab and international organizations, consuls and military attachés accredited to Tunisia, university presidents, academics, media professionals, artists and Tunisian intellectuals and a number of Omani students studying in Tunisia.

Ambassador Hilal Abdullah Ali Alsanani delivered a speech on this occasion in which he commended the relations of cooperation between the two brotherly countries in various fields.

In turn, Tunisian Minister of Education praised the strong relations between the Sultanate of Oman and the Republic of Tunisia and the joint cooperation in various fields.

During the reception, a documentary featuring the Omani Renaissance was screened, along with microfilms highlighting Oman Vision 2040.
